使用此对话框可以设置 SQL Server Management Studio 中的所有五个编辑器的常规编辑选项。 若要显示这些选项,请在**“工具”菜单上单击“选项”。 选择“文本编辑器”文件夹,展开“所有语言”文件夹,再单击“常规”**。
通过编辑器进行的选项设置
您必须使用**“所有语言”**对话框来设置 DMX、MDX 和 SQL Server Compact 编辑器的选项。 此处设置的选项也适用于纯文本、Transact-SQL 和 XML 编辑器,但您可以通过展开这些语言的子文件夹并选择相应的选项页面来为这些编辑器单独设置选项。
![]() |
---|
如果您使用此对话框设置了选项,但希望在纯文本、Transact-SQL 或 XML 编辑器中使用不同设置,则必须在“所有语言”对话框中应用选项之后为这些编辑器设置选项。 |
某些编辑器只能支持本页面上列出的部分选项。 如果已经在**“选项”对话框的“常规”**页上为某些编程语言选择了某个选项,而没有为其他语言选择该选项,则会显示带阴影的选中标记。
语句结束
自动列出成员
当您在编辑器中键入内容时,将显示可用的成员、属性或值的弹出列表。 从弹出列表中任选一项,即可将其插入到代码中。 选中此复选框将启用**“隐藏高级成员”**选项。隐藏高级成员
通过仅显示那些最常用的项来缩短弹出语句结束列表。 其他项将从该列表中筛选出去。 如果没有成员标记为高级成员,此选项将不可用。参数信息
在编辑器中,当前声明或过程的完整语法会显示在插入点的左侧,并显示其所有可用参数。 下一个可分配参数以粗体显示。
设置
启用虚拟空间
注释在代码旁的位置将保持不变。 选中此复选框之后,可以将光标放置在行中的最后一个字符之外。 键入内容时,将自动添加制表符和空格以结束到插入点的行。自动换行
在下一行中显示将行水平延伸到编辑器可见区域之外的所有部分。 选中此复选框将启用**“显示可视的自动换行标志符号”**选项。显示可视的自动换行标志符号
在长行换行的位置显示返回箭头指示符。注意
这些提示箭头不会添加到代码中,也不会打印出来。 它们仅供参考。 有些类型的编辑器中未提供此功能。
没有选定内容时对空行应用剪切或复制命令
设置将插入点放在空行中,不选择任何内容,再单击**“复制”或“剪切”**时的编辑器行为。如果选中此复选框,将复制或剪切空白行。 如果随后单击**“粘贴”**,将插入一个新空白行。
如果此复选框处于未选中状态,则不复制或剪切任何内容。 如果随后单击**“粘贴”**,将粘贴最近一次复制的内容。 如果尚未复制任何内容,则不会粘贴任何内容。
如果所在行不是空白行,则此设置对**“复制”或“剪切”无效。 如果没有选定任何内容,将复制或剪切整个行。 如果随后单击“粘贴”**,将粘贴整个行的文本及其行终止符。
显示
行号
在每行代码的旁边显示行号。注意
这些行号不会添加到代码中,也不会打印出来。 它们仅供参考。
启用单击 URL 定位
当光标移至编辑器的 URL 上方时将变为手形指针符号。 您可以单击 URL 以在 Web 浏览器中显示所指示的页。导航栏
在代码编辑器的顶端显示导航栏。 使用其**“对象”和“过程”**下拉列表可以选择代码中的特定对象,再从所列的过程中进行选择,然后插入所选过程的实例。 并不是所有代码类型都可使用导航栏。